Overview
We are seeking an experienced Technical Sales Manager to join a globally operating manufacturer of passenger information systems for the public transport sector. The company designs, develops, and manufactures its products in the UK, with a growing presence through subsidiaries across Europe, North America, and Australasia.
Following a period of significant growth, the business is rolling out a cloud-based software platform that enables customers to remotely monitor and update onboard equipment in real time. This role presents an opportunity to play a key part in this exciting phase of digital transition and innovation.
The successful candidate will take ownership of technical sales activities, particularly focused on SaaS solutions and complex system offerings. This includes supporting existing sales teams on technical bids and tenders, and leading engagement for newly developed integrated products such as bus stop displays, requiring an understanding of both hardware and software.
Key Responsibilities
Lead technical sales efforts with a focus on cloud-based SaaS platforms and complex systems.
Build strong relationships with internal teams and external clients to support the migration from legacy to next-generation products.
Conduct customer visits, product demonstrations, and manage technical sales queries, quotations, and tender documentation.
Assist in onboarding customers to cloud-based platforms and ensure ongoing support and satisfaction.
Identify and develop new business opportunities for recently launched software and integrated product lines.
Monitor and report on the progress of customer roll-outs for cloud solutions.
Stay informed on public transport industry trends and emerging technologies.
Contribute to the development and execution of the technical and software sales strategy.
Essential Requirements
Extensive experience in sales and customer management at a senior level.
Proven track record of selling IT and cloud-based SaaS technologies.
High technical aptitude, with the ability to quickly learn how hardware interfaces with serial, Ethernet, and other communication protocols.
Strong understanding of cloud technologies and the ability to clearly explain technical concepts such as software functionality, hosting, and security to a range of stakeholders.
Commercially astute with strong business analysis skills.
Excellent communication skills with the ability to build trust and effectively manage internal and external relationships.
Capable of managing work and priorities in a fast-paced technical environment.
Self-driven with a results-focused mindset.
Knowledge or experience within the public transport or bus industry.
Desired Skills (Not Mandatory)
Some familiarity with electronics and on-vehicle electrical systems (troubleshooting, hardware/software interface).
Additional language skills, especially French, Spanish, or German.
